    Lindsay H.

    Smack dab in the middle of a beautiful area of town with Igreja do Carmo, Livraria Lello, and countless parks and shops nearby. As we decided against the insane line at the famed bookstore, we kept walking in pursuit of a fresh and healthy-ish breakfast and a caffeine fix. Yelp told us Noshi was the place to be! You walk in and it looks small and quaint with just two tables and the large coffee bar front and center. However, it does go back farther to another seating area with a skylight, plants, cute artwork, and a unisex bathroom that shares a sink and breaks off into two small separate toilet spaces (including a baby changing station in one). We were greeted kindly and promptly. We were seated in a 2-top next to the bar and ordered coffees and water. It was fun watching them in action. Note that the shop offers sugar for coffee. If you need SF/low-sugar, they give agave...which tastes unique. Be weird and bring your own packets, if this is a deal-breaker. The coffee is very smooth and flavorful. The menu is unique and expansive, as is the list of coffee creations. We ordered the salmon croissant and the bacon toast. However, there was a language-based miscommunication (that's what I get for attempting to speak in full Portuguese without the skills. Oops!). Instead of the bacon toast with arugula, turkey bacon, avo, poached eggs, etc, I received plain toast. After I kindly apologized and sent it back, I saw frustrated kitchen and heard a few choice words. Other than this blip, our experience was great. Our server was very sweet, the food has just enough flavor and powered us up for the day, the coffee tasty, and the space bright and welcoming.

    Lauren C.

    Absolutely loved this place. I came here right after arriving in Porto to grab a snack and cup of coffee, and it ended up being my favorite spot of the trip! The menu had tons of vegan options that were very well labeled. I started with a large cup of chemex coffee that was generously portioned and delicious. (I didn't realize until later how hard it would be to find filter coffee - available mostly only at specialty coffee shops and there only in tiny portions for a relatively high price.) I also loved the vegan oat "simple pancakes" topped with fruit. The pink chia pudding was the least exciting thing I had there (some clumps of seeds that weren't completely mixed in) but still good with all the fruit garnishes.

    5 for beauty, zero for prices!! What a tourist trap. I walked in on a quiet morning wanting a small…read morecup of coffee or drink prior to an appointment I was early for. I was absolutely shook at the prices. 7€ for a pingo? (A sip of expresso with a drop of milk and the cup is slightly bigger than two or three thimbles. To compare, you can go most anywhere else and pay about 1€ for a pingo.) 8/9 euros for a hot chocolate? You can get cup of milk for 3/4 euros though, at the store you can get a whole liter for .89€ Listen, I am 100% sure being in this cafe is a dream for some potter fans but it is sad that the prices are that insane, but... clearly people pay them. I politely excused myself and I walked across the way and had two pork rissóis and a cup of coffee (not a baby pingo- think cappuccino size) for 3€... and for free, the real Portuguese experience with locals. The people I engaged with were lovely and kind here. This review is for the prices. Not the food, drinks, or service. Let's be real, of course ambiance is off the chart gorgeous. So if you don't mind a 50€ tab for 3-4 baby, baby coffees maybe just take a picture from the outside and call it good. There are more local and authentic things to do in Porto than pay 7€ for an orange juice or pingo.
